A pizza is being recalled from supermarkets following a mis-labelling error.

A Zizzi pizza has been recalled

A Zizzi pizza has been recalled (Image: Zizzi)

A Zizzi pizza sold in supermarkets across the UK has been recalled. The pizza brand is recalling some of its ‘Zizzi Vegan Jackfruit Pepperoni Rustica Pizza’ from Tesco, Morrrisons and Waitrose.

The pizzas contain milk, despite the label calling it a vegan pizza. This poses a health risk to those with milk allergies or intolerances. Any pizza with the batch code of 5105 or best before date of July 15 2026 is included in this recall. People who have purchased one are advised to return it to the store of purchase for a full refund, with or without a receipt. Zizzi has been advised to contact the relevanrt allergy support organisations, which informs their members of recallls. Point-of-sale notices ar ebeing displayed in stores where the product is stocked.

This comes after Iceland announced a recall or one of their popular items, urging customers to “not eat” it. The supermarket is recalling the Daily Bakery 4 Sub Rolls as it may contain barley not mentioned on the label.

The presence of barley is a potential risk to anyone who has an allergy or intolerance to gluten. Customers who have bought the item are being asked to return it to their nearest Iceland store. A refund will be provided.

Customers who have purchased Myprotein Gooey Filled Cookie Double Chocolate & Caramel from Tesco, Asda, Morrisons and Boots are being alerted to potential health hazards

The product, available in two sizes, contains an undeclared wheat protein which could be harmful to those with wheat or gluten allergies or intolerances, including coeliac disease.
